FESTIVITIES

The festivities schedule in Antequera around the year has its most important events on the following date:

 CARNIVAL.- A real explosion of joy and humour on the previous days to the Holy Week. Funny bands contests, masks and fancy dressed people parades.

 HOLY WEEK.- The procession of the religious images in Antequera is characteristic because of the antiquity and beauty of its materials,
statuesque by the famous sculptors Pablo de Rojas (16th. century), José de Mora (17th. century), Andrés de Carvajal, Miguel Márquez García (18th. century), etc., set going through streets and squares with its artistic thrones visiting the most typical corners of the town.

 SPRING FAIR- Keeps on the 31st May through the 3rd.June.

 ROYAL AUGUST FAIRS.- Is the most important festivity in Antequera, and it keeps on the 21st August.
In the old Bull Ring (built in 1848), there are bull fights with the most famous Spanish matadors. Cavalcades, shows, fair-stalls and many rides and amusements.

 8th OF SEPTEMBER.- Festivity of Our Lady of the Remedy, patron saint of the town.
Verbena on the night before and procession of the holy image on the saint's day.
